Schweitzer holds 480 US patents across 75 technology areas, rank #929 of 50,000 tracked assignees.
Schweitzer Engineering Laboratories, Inc. has been granted 480 US utility patents between 2015 and 2025, placing Schweitzer Engineering Laboratories, Inc. at rank #929 across all assignees tracked by PlainPatent. This portfolio spans 75 distinct Cooperative Patent Classification (CPC) subclasses, averaging 18.4 claims per patent with primary concentration in G01R (MEASURING ELECTRIC VARIABLES; MEASURING MAGNETIC VARIABLES). Filing cadence tells the strategic story. Between 2020 and 2025 the company received 322 grants, compared with 158 in the 2015–2019 window, a +104% shift in five-year velocity. An acceleration of this magnitude signals aggressive R&D investment and expanding technical ambition. | Year | Patents Granted | Share of Period |
|---|---|---|
| 2015 | 20 | 4.2% |
| 2016 | 26 | 5.4% |
| 2017 | 33 | 6.9% |
| 2018 | 28 | 5.8% |
| 2019 | 51 | 10.6% |
| 2020 | 60 | 12.5% |
| 2021 | 81 | 16.9% |
| 2022 | 60 | 12.5% |
| 2023 | 59 | 12.3% |
| 2024 | 41 | 8.5% |
| 2025 | 21 | 4.4% |
